What Equipment Financing Means for Kensington Businesses

Equipment financing is a secured loan structure where the equipment itself serves as collateral. Lenders advance funds to purchase or refinance machinery, vehicles, computers, or specialized tools, and the borrower repays over a term that often matches the asset's useful life. Because the equipment secures the loan, underwriters focus on the asset's value and your ability to service the debt, not just credit scores. How the Equipment-Financing Process Works

Underwriters start by appraising the equipment. They order valuations or review invoices to confirm fair market value, then verify your business cash flow can cover the payment. Most lenders require two years of tax returns, recent bank statements, and a current profit-and-loss statement. What types of equipment qualify for financing in Kensington?+
Most income-producing assets qualify: commercial vehicles, kitchen equipment, medical devices, computers, manufacturing machinery, and construction tools. Lenders typically avoid consumer goods or assets with no resale value. Dawn Funding Group reviews your invoice or quote to confirm eligibility before you apply.
How long does equipment-financing approval take?+
Approval timelines range from a few days to three weeks, depending on the lender, asset complexity, and documentation completeness. Straightforward purchases with current financials and clear invoices close faster. Dawn Funding Group pre-screens your file to eliminate common delays before submission.
Can I finance used equipment in Kensington?+
Yes. Many lenders finance used equipment if it retains sufficient value and useful life. Underwriters order appraisals or review comparable sales to confirm collateral adequacy. Dawn Funding Group connects you with lenders experienced in valuing pre-owned assets across industries.
Do I need a down payment for equipment financing?+
Down-payment requirements vary by lender, asset age, and borrower strength. Some programs finance the full purchase price; others require ten to twenty percent down. Dawn Funding Group explains each lender's structure so you can plan your cash outlay before committing.
